Up for sale, a 2008 Fender Telecaster Custom '62 vintage reissue model in near mint, 100% original condition and in perfect working order with factory-installed Fender USA-made Texas Special pickups. This "Made in Japan" Telecaster is a rare model, meant only for the Japanese domestic market, featuring a rare transparent Cherry gloss finish on the alder body framed by ivory binding on the top and back.Officially model TL62B-80TX, this Telecaster came stock from the factory with Fender USA-made Texas Special black bobbin pickups. These pickups offer a bit more kick than your traditional Tele single coil while retaining a vintage-flavored twang, snap, and chewy cut. With great clarity and chime in every position on the three-way switch, there's a biting treble response in the bridge position and smooth, sweet tones at the neck. The guitar weighs 8lbs 2oz, professionally setup here at Mike & Mike's Guitar Bar with 10-46 strings and low action.The maple neck has a modestly chunky C-shaped profile carve with full shoulders and lightly rolled fretboard edges, measuring .850" deep at the 1st fret and .970" at the 12th. The thick slab rosewood fretboard features a vintage-spec 7 1/4" fretboard radius and retains the original slender fretwire which has its full factory height and well-rounded crowns, showing only light wear beneath the plain strings on frets 1-3. The guitar plays cleanly up the 25 1/2" scale, and the neck is straight with an optimally adjusted and responsive truss rod. The nut measures 42mm in width (1.650"). On the headstock, the Kluson-style Gotoh tuning machines turn smoothly and hold pitch well. The "Made in Japan" text and T-prefix serial is present above the four-bolt neck plate.All of the stock electronics work as they should, with the USA-made Fender Texas Special pickups governed by Master Volume and Tone controls with knurled knobs. The chrome hardware shines like new, and the bridge is complete with vintage-spec spiral saddles. The transparent Cherry gloss is accented by a three-ply parchment pickguard, and cosmetic wear is limited to a few tiny nicks and faint finish scratches on the body as a whole. The lightly ambered gloss finish on the neck profile is nigh flawless.A gigbag is included.
